Phestilla is a genus of sea slugs, aeolid nudibranchs, marine gastropod molluscs in the family Trinchesiidae.
Its members are unusual in feeding on hard corals, unlike other members of the family Trinchesiidae which feed on hydroids. Adult Phestilla have no cnidosacs. This genus has been investigated using DNA phylogeny and undescribed species exist.Korshunova, T.; Martynov, A.; Picton, B. (2017). Species

- Phestilla chaetopterana (Ekimova, Deart & Schepetov, 2017)
- Phestilla fuscostriata Hu, Zhang, Xie & Qiu, 2020
- Phestilla goniophaga Hu, Zhang, Yiu, Xie & Qui, 2020
- Phestilla lugubris (Bergh, 1870)
- Phestilla melanobrachia Bergh, 1874
- Phestilla minor Rudman, 1981
- Phestilla panamica Rudman, 1982
- Phestilla poritophages (Rudman, 1979)

- Phestilla subodiosa A. Wang, Conti-Jerpe, J. L. Richards & D. M. Baker, 2020
- Phestilla viei Mehrotra, Caballer & Chavanich in Mehrotra, Arnold, Wang, Chavanich, Hoeksema & Caballer, 2020
Species names currently considered to be synonyms:
- Phestilla hakunamatata Ortea, Caballer & Espinosa, 2003 synonym of Hermosita hakunamatata (Ortea, Caballer & Espinosa, 2003)
- Phestilla subodiosus A. Wang, Conti-Jerpe, J. L. Richards & D. M. Baker, 2020 : synonym of Phestilla subodiosa A. Wang, Conti-Jerpe, J. L. Richards & D. M. Baker, 2020 (incorrect gender agreement of specific epithet)
